Frequently asked questions about resorts in Northumberland

  • What are the top attractions in Northumberland, United Kingdom?

    For a taste of Northumberland's highlights, Alnwick Castle, with its stunning architecture and Harry Potter filming location fame, is a must-see. Hadrian's Wall, a UNESCO World Heritage site, offers a journey through Roman history, with sections like Housesteads Roman Fort particularly impressive. Lindisfarne (Holy Island), accessible at low tide, boasts a magnificent tidal island setting and a historic priory. The Farne Islands, a haven for wildlife, especially seabirds, are also incredibly popular.

  • What types of natural scenery can visitors see in Northumberland, United Kingdom?

    Northumberland boasts diverse landscapes. The dramatic coastline, with its rugged cliffs and sandy beaches like Bamburgh Beach, is breathtaking. The Cheviot Hills offer stunning upland scenery, perfect for hiking and exploring. The Northumberland National Park showcases vast, open moorland and rolling hills.
  • What are the best pet friendly resorts in Northumberland?

  • Are there particular times of year when Northumberland’s landscapes or wildlife undergo striking seasonal changes?

    Yes, absolutely. Spring sees the hillsides bloom with wildflowers, and the birdlife on the Farne Islands is at its peak during nesting season (roughly April to August). Autumn brings vibrant colours to the woodlands and heather moorland. Winter offers a stark, beautiful landscape with potential for snow in the higher areas.

  • What are the lesser-known but fascinating attractions in Northumberland, United Kingdom?

    The Rothbury area, with its charming town and Simonside Hills, is often overlooked. The Northumberland Coast AONB (Area of Outstanding Natural Beauty) offers hidden coves and dramatic cliff walks beyond the more popular spots. Exploring the numerous castles and stately homes beyond Alnwick, like Warkworth Castle, reveals more of the county's rich history.
